springbootioc启动
时间: 2023-08-21 14:09:24 浏览: 32
在Spring Boot中,使用IoC(Inversion of Control)容器启动一个应用程序非常简单。首先,确保你已经在项目的依赖中添加了Spring Boot的相关依赖。
接下来,你需要创建一个主应用程序类。这个类应该使用`@SpringBootApplication`注解进行标记,这个注解是一个组合注解,包括了`@Configuration`、`@EnableAutoConfiguration`和`@ComponentScan`。
在主应用程序类中,你可以通过创建一个`SpringApplication`对象,并调用其`run()`方法来启动应用程序。这个方法会自动扫描并加载类路径下的所有组件,并创建相应的Bean。
下面是一个简单的示例:
```java
import org.springframework.boot.SpringApplication;
import org.springframework.boot.autoconfigure.SpringBootApplication;
@SpringBootApplication
public class MyApplication {
public static void main(String[] args) {
SpringApplication.run(MyApplication.class, args);
}
}
```
这样,你的Spring Boot应用程序就可以通过IoC容器启动了。在启动过程中,Spring Boot会自动加载并初始化所有的配置和组件,并根据需要注入相应的依赖。
希望这可以帮助到你!如果还有其他问题,请随时提问。
相关推荐
![java](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)